Orchid Drive is in Red Lodge, Bury St. Edmunds and in Forest Heath district. IP28 8GR is located in the Iceni elect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of West Suffolk. This postcode has been in use since 2007-08-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ding IP28 8GR is primarily male, with 53.6% of the population being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).

Health

Across the UK, the average 48.4% rated their health as Very Good, 33.6% as Good, 12.7% as Fair, 4% as Bad, and 1.2% as Very Bad.

Population age significantly impacts residents' health. Additionally, socioeconomic status plays a crucial role: higher income levels and lower poverty rates are linked to better health outcomes. Affluent areas benefit from higher living standards, access to private healthcare, and healthier lifestyle choices.

This area has a high percentage of residents reporting their health as Good or Very Good (88.2%) compared to the average (82%). This typically indicates either a younger population or more affluent area.

Safety

Is Orchid Drive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Orchid Drive was 35.2 per 1,000 residents, which is 63.3% higher than the Chedburgh & Chevington average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Orchid Drive has the 19th highest crime rate of 55 local areas in Chedburgh & Chevington and the 277th lowest crime rate of 587 local areas in West Suffolk .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 26.4 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-78.5%.
